Having spent some time digging in to the remaining time-out issue, it looks to be the same problem as we've seen before with there being a discrepancy between the type inference results obtained by NativeInterpreter and custom abstract interpreters.

Why a type inference discrepancy would cause such a significant slowdown? Also, feel free to disable respective tests in this PR so we can merge it—this is not really a Tapir issue.

@willtebbutt
Copy link
Member

Why a type inference discrepancy would cause such a significant slowdown?

It causes a lot of downstream type instabilities in low-level functions, which causes a 100x-1000x slowdown (very approximately).

Also, feel free to disable respective tests in this PR so we can merge it—this is not really a Tapir issue.

Good idea. I'll open proper issues in Tapir / Cthulhu and, once I've done this, disable some of these tests.
